Birmingham-Sicilian chef Angelina Adamo launches her first bricks-and-mortar restaurant tomorrow (Saturday 7 February) – Vieni, in the new Goodsyard development in the city’s Jewellery Quarter. A graduate of University College Birmingham, Angelina trained at Simpson’s in Edgbaston and runs her own private dining company, Tutto Apposto, which also operates the Circle Lounge in the Birmingham Hippodrome.
